How much does SkinnyRx cost compared to Breeze Meds?

SkinnyRx starts at $199/month ($199/mo semaglutide, up to $349/mo for tirzepatide), while Breeze Meds starts at $199/month (estimated starting price, medication included).

Do SkinnyRx and Breeze Meds accept insurance?

SkinnyRx does not accept insurance. Breeze Meds does not accept insurance.

Which GLP-1 medications does SkinnyRx offer vs Breeze Meds?

SkinnyRx offers Compounded Semaglutide (Injectable), Compounded Semaglutide (Sublingual), Compounded Tirzepatide (Injectable), Compounded Tirzepatide (Tablets). Breeze Meds offers Compounded Semaglutide, Compounded Tirzepatide.
